We just got the new Works Bell QRS system. Approximately 26.7mm thick, it’s much thinner than the original Rapfix system. This new adapter also features a patent pending “roller & ball lock system,” which holds the steering wheel firmly in place. It’s recommended to be used with Works Bell hubs to insure that the QRS locking flaps will be compatible.

WedsSport introduces the new SA-55M wheel. Weds uses Advanced Metal Forming technology to create a durable race wheel. Like many Japanese wheel companies, Weds is always innovating the design. These wheels feature a uniquely machined trim in between each pair of split spokes. With the dark aggressive colors and the subtle machined touch, these will definitely look great on both race and show cars.
Available Colors:
BBM [Black Blue Machining]
MGM [Matte Gray Machining]
Available Sizes and weights:
18×8″ +35,+45 offset (18.58lbs each)
18×9″ +20,+36 offset (19.53lbs each)
18×10″ +18,+36 (20.45lbs each)

We just received some photos from Voltex Japan. The aero kit for the s2000 is already in progress. Rest assured, the craftsmanship is top notch and done by Mr. Nakajima himself, the founder of Voltex. He’s also considering adding wide fenders to the front and rear. We are hoping to get the first prototype by the end of this year and will debut it during competition at Super Lap Battle.

Yet another exhaust option for Honda S2000 owners, HKS has just released a limited edition, cat-back Carbon Ti exhaust system made specifically for the S2000.
The system is basically a high-end version of the Hi-Power exhaust with stainless steel mufflers wrapped in carbon fiber. The piping is also stainless steel while the tips are titanium.
Previously, this HKS series was only available for turbo cars such as EVO, WRX/STi, and Supra. S2000 owners should definitley order one while they’re still available, especially if you were already thinking about getting an HKS exhaust!
